In a bizarre yet captivating event, crypto entrepreneur Justin Sun made headlines after consuming a banana artwork that he purchased for a staggering $6.2 million. The artwork, famously created by Italian artist Maurizio Cattelan, features a banana duct-taped to a wall and has sparked conversations about the value of art in the contemporary market.
During a recent news conference, Sun showcased the artwork by participating in a unique twist on the original concept. Guests were invited to create their own versions of the banana art using real bananas and duct tape, transforming the event into an interactive art experience. Sun's act of eating the banana was both a statement on the absurdity of high-value art and a demonstration of his unconventional approach to investment in the digital realm.
This event not only highlights the intersection of art and cryptocurrency but also raises questions about the nature of value in a world where digital assets and physical art can command eye-watering prices. Sun's actions are sure to fuel ongoing debates about the meaning and purpose of contemporary art in today's society.
